About SMCO

The Sub-Adviser uses its proprietary Small & Mid Cap Opportunities investment process (“SMCO Process”) to seek risk-adjusted returns by investing in U.S. equity securities within the small- and mid-cap asset classes. The fund’s portfolio will typically consist of between 50-75 stocks. The fund’s portfolio will consistently consist of stocks that the Sub-Adviser deems fundamentally attractive and reasonably valued. Under normal circumstances, at least 80% of the fund’s net assets, plus borrowings for investment purposes, will be invested in equity securities of small- and mid-capitalization companies.
